Google Payment Privacy Settings Hidden Behind Special URL

Google Pay is a payment service from Google that allows you to purchase items online and in stores by using stored payment information. Google is hiding three Google Pay privacy settings unless you access the service’s Settings screen through a special URL. These settings allow you to restrict whether Google Pay shares your creditworthiness, personal information, or Google Pay account information.
